LDV Deliver 7 Cars
The LDV Deliver 7 is a versatile and practical light commercial vehicle that suits the diverse demands of New Zealand businesses, from urban deliveries to rural transportation. With its spacious interior and robust build, the Deliver 7 offers an excellent balance between cargo capacity and drivability, making it a strong contender in the competitive light truck segment.
Under the bonnet, the Deliver 7 typically features a turbocharged diesel engine designed to provide reliable torque and fuel efficiency – qualities essential for navigating New Zealand’s mixed driving conditions. Whether tackling city traffic in Auckland or handling longer stretches on rural roads and highways, the engine’s responsiveness and fuel economy help reduce running costs for operators who often cover extensive distances across varied terrain.
The chassis and suspension setup of the LDV Deliver 7 is tuned to manage New Zealand’s sometimes challenging road surfaces, including uneven rural roads and motorway journeys. Its sturdy frame provides good load stability without compromising ride comfort. The van’s turning circle is also engineered to aid maneuverability in tight urban environments like Wellington's narrow streets or shopping precincts throughout Christchurch.
Inside, the driver benefits from a comfortable cabin featuring ergonomic seating and straightforward controls designed with long hours on the road in mind. Visibility is enhanced by large windows and mirrors suited for monitoring tight spaces common in NZ city centres. Additionally, safety features such as electronic stability control and multiple airbags provide peace of mind when sharing roads with other vehicles, cyclists, and pedestrians.
For tradespeople or courier companies requiring adaptability, the LDV Deliver 7 offers configurable cargo options including high roof versions that maximise vertical storage space while remaining compliant with New Zealand’s height restrictions on most roads.
Overall, the LDV Deliver 7 is a practical workhorse well adapted to meet New Zealand’s diverse driving environment—from bustling urban hubs to sprawling rural routes—offering reliability, efficiency, and functional design.
